There is a significant gap in the cost of living between these two cities. Foot of Ten is 28% cheaper than South Montrose. With a cost index of 63 vs 88, the difference would have a meaningful impact on a household's monthly budget. Someone relocating from Foot of Ten to South Montrose should plan for substantially higher expenses across most categories.

When it comes to buying, median home values in Foot of Ten are $139,200 compared to $178,100 in South Montrose, a 22% gap.

Median household income in Foot of Ten is $53,625 compared to $53,917 in South Montrose (-0.5%). South Montrose does offer higher incomes, but the salary premium barely offsets the higher cost of living, leaving residents with a tighter budget.
